About this contract

The Learning in Harmony Multi Academy Trust (LiHT), based in London and Southend, includes a mix of older traditional school buildings and newer facilities or extensions. The Trust comprises 14 schools several of which are spread over multiple sites. A SEND school is due to be built by September 2026. Temporary accommodation has been built which will provide up to 40 SEND places until the permanent school is completed.Please refer to the tender documentation for further information around sites not included within this tender. The Learning in Harmony MAT is conducting a tender process to award a contract for the provision of ‘Planned and Preventative Maintenance’ services to commence on 4 November 2025.
